Day ahead of Chhattisgarh polls, Naxal attack injures BSF jawan in IED blast
11/11/2018 10:55:41 AM

At least one BSF jawan was injured on Sunday in an IED blast after a Naxal attack at Kanker district in election-bound Chhattisgarh.

The jawans were conducting a search when the Naxals launched an attack.

A set of six IEDs were planted in a series and were set off in one go between the villages of Gome and Gattakal in Koyali beda.


A BSF ASI, identified as Mahendra Singh, was injured in the blast in Kanker district's Koyali beda. The jawan will be treated at Antagarh Hospital.

Meanwhile, in another encounter with security forces, a Maoist was killed and another apprehended in Bijapur district on Saturday. Reportedly, arms and ammunition were also recovered.

The encounter is still underway between security forces and Maoists.

The attack comes in less than a fortnight after two security forces personnel and Doordarshan cameraman were killed in an attack by Naxals in Aranpur in Chhattisgarh's Dantewada district on Tuesday
